透过OWA登录界面改密码对于使用Exchange的用户来说是一个很有有用的功能。 因为如果用户不在公司域环境中,当密码已经到期登录不了OWA,就没有办法通过OWA中的【选项】来改密码,当开启这项功能后,管理员和用户都可以很方便的处理密码到期的case。

早在Exchange2010的时候,我们需要通过修改CAS服务器的注册表项来实现这个功能。现在的Exchange2013已经内置了该功能,并且在最新的Exchange2013 SP1和CU5版本中,此功能已再次更新,客户端访问服务器上已经设置为默认开启状态,使用前只需要确认该功能属性的状态就可以了。

我们可以输入下面的命令来检查OWA改密码的功能状态

Get-OwaVirtualDirectory -Server <servername> | fl changepasswordenabled

clip_p_w_picpath002

如果执行命令后看到的状态是“FALSE”,那就需要使用下面的命令手动开启一下该功能

  Get-OwaVirtualDirectory -Server <servername> | Set-OwaVirtualDirectory -ChangePasswordEnabled $true

clip_p_w_picpath004

功能确认开启后,我们来验证下该功能。

我们手动修改用户账户的登陆属性,让给user1下次登录时必须改密码

clip_p_w_picpath005

现在以user1身份登录OWA看是否会提示用户修改密码

clip_p_w_picpath007

OWA友好的提醒user1,密码已经过期了,必须先修改密码后才能登陆OWA

clip_p_w_picpath009

我们依次输入新旧密码后,看看是否能正常提交

clip_p_w_picpath011

成功提交请求后提示密码已修改成功

clip_p_w_picpath013

我们来输入新的密码,测试是否能正常登陆OWA

clip_p_w_picpath015

已经成功登录